Bangladesh announces February 12 polls after Hasina’s ouster

Dhaka: Bangladesh will hold the 13th parliamentary election February 12, Chief Election Commissioner AMM Nasir Uddin announced Thursday.

This will be the first election after Prime Minister Sheikh Hasina was ousted in a violent student-led protest in August 2024.

“The voting will be held Thursday, February 12, 2026,” the CEC said.
